Comment 3 Robert-André Mauchin 🐧 2020-08-27 15:27:39 UTC
 - I don't think it is necessary to include:

for cmd in fuzz; do
  %gobuild -o %{gobuilddir}/bin/$(basename $cmd) %{goipath}/$cmd
done


 Main binary is 3mux.


 - License ok
 - Latest version packaged
 - Builds in mock
 - No rpmlint errors
 - Conforms to Packaging Guidelines

Package approved.
